Taxonomic Classification
| Rank | Capucin de Nouvelle-Bretagne | Capucin jacobin |
|---|---|---|
| Kingdom same | Animalia (animal) | Animalia (animal) |
| Phylum same | Chordata (Chordates) | Chordata (Chordates) |
| Class same | Aves (oiseau) | Aves (oiseau) |
| Order same | Passeriformes (passereaux) | Passeriformes (passereaux) |
| Family same | Estrildidae | Estrildidae |
| Genus same | Lonchura | Lonchura |
| Species | Lonchura melaena | Lonchura molucca |
Evolutionary Relationship
Capucin de Nouvelle-Bretagne and Capucin jacobin share a common ancestor at the Genus level: Lonchura.
